GIRLS OPENING ROUND RESULTS

With 57% of the vote, modern Laken made it past imported Kyomi. Laken has been such a lightning rod of a name over the years, but it fits in well with the Nature Plus name trend so it’s not surprising to see it back in the US Top 1000.

With nearly 68% of the tally, Odette bested Elara. Like Laken, Odette has been talked about for ages. It feels like it could follow Charlotte, Scarlett, and Colette up the popularity charts – at last. But don’t count Elara out, especially with Eliana entering the US Top Ten.

Mariel decisively defeated Darla with over 76% of the total. Last year, Mariella was out in the opening round. Spare Mariel feels like it might fare better.

By a comfortable margin, Winifred knocked out Eliora with just over 60% of the score. Winnie has been climbing for some time. The return of this formal name option just makes sense.
